Ordinals
beta
Sat 1372556919201725
decimal
339022.1919201725
degree
0°129022′334″1919201725‴
percentile
65.3598533672161%
name
ecylfnxbpxs
cycle
0
epoch
1
period
168
block
339022
offset
1919201725
timestamp
2015-01-15 06:38:25 UTC
rarity
common
prev
next